The American housing market has changed dramatically in recent years. In many major cities, home prices have reached levels that make buying a house feel impossible for the average person. But across the United States, there are still cities where homeownership remains surprisingly affordable.

In this video, we explore the cheapest cities to buy a house in America, looking at housing prices, local economic history, and the reasons these markets remain more affordable than the national average. From historic Midwestern industrial cities to growing southern metropolitan areas, these housing markets reveal a different side of the U.S. real estate landscape.

You will learn how cities like Detroit, Cleveland, Memphis, Pittsburgh, Buffalo, Tulsa, and Indianapolis maintain lower housing prices while still offering established neighborhoods and stable communities. We also explain the economic and historical factors that shaped these housing markets and why affordability still exists in certain parts of the country.
